3 Key Points

  1. Researchers analyzed 1,357 basic vocabulary forms from six Sulawesi Austronesian languages to detect non-inherited words

  2. XGBoost classifier achieved 0.763 AUC by analyzing 26 phonological features to distinguish inherited from non-mainstream vocabulary

  3. Identified substrate forms show distinctive phonological patterns: longer length, more consonant clusters, higher glottal stops, and fewer Austronesian prefixes

  4. 26.5% of analyzed vocabulary (438 forms) identified as potential candidates for pre-Austronesian substrate origin through computational methods
